Marketing Volunteer

Lancashire Women

Why this role matters

Lancashire Women exists to create real, lasting change for women across the region. But change starts with stories. This volunteer role is about helping us capture and share the impact our services make – in the words, images and moments that show what’s really possible when women get the right support.

What you’ll be doing

You’ll work alongside the marketing manager to bring Lancashire Women’s work to life across our channels. This includes gathering social media content from our centres (photos, videos, and stories) and drafting posts that reflect what we do and present us professionally.

You’ll also have the opportunity to attend community events with us, representing the charity and talking to people about our work. Beyond social media, you’ll be supporting with content for our website, articles and mailings, and help out with other general marketing tasks as they arise.

What we offer

You’ll have full support from an experienced marketing manager throughout your time with us. This is a genuine opportunity to build your portfolio, develop practical skills in charity communications, and be part of a team doing meaningful work. 

All volunteers are required to complete an Enhanced DBS check, which will be fully funded by Lancashire Women.

When we need support

We are currently looking for volunteers who can offer their time on either Mondays or Wednesdays with some flexibility to attend day-time events. These would be planned in advance.

About Lancashire Women

What We Do:
We offer a whole person approach to supporting women which is trauma informed and can be accessed directly by women themselves and / or through a referral:

We can help with :

Mental health issues and general health and well-being
Money Advice / Debt and wider welfare support issues
Getting into employment with coaching, skills development and confidence building
We also work in the prevention and rehabilitation of women connected to the criminal justice system with expertise in addressing multiple and complex unmet needs of women who have been moved from pillar to post across services and agencies.
